.Login-module__0PyEKq__pageWrapper{color:#111;background:#fff;justify-content:center;align-items:center;margin:0;font-family:Arial,sans-serif;display:flex}.Login-module__0PyEKq__loginBox{text-align:center;width:100%;max-width:380px;padding:20px}.Login-module__0PyEKq__googleButtonWrapper{margin-bottom:24px!important}.Login-module__0PyEKq__heading{letter-spacing:3px;color:#000;font-size:32px;font-weight:800;line-height:1.2;font-family:var(--lora-font);margin-top:0;margin-bottom:24px}.Login-module__0PyEKq__googleBtn{cursor:pointer;color:#000;width:100%;font-size:16px;font-weight:500;font-family:var(--montserrat-font);background:#fff;border:1px solid #2a4996;border-radius:6px;justify-content:center;align-items:center;gap:10px;padding:10px;display:flex}.Login-module__0PyEKq__googleBtn img{height:18px}.Login-module__0PyEKq__divider{text-align:center;color:#000;margin:10px 0 24px;font-size:14px;font-weight:700;position:relative}.Login-module__0PyEKq__divider:before,.Login-module__0PyEKq__divider:after{content:"";background:#000;width:45%;height:1px;position:absolute;top:50%}.Login-module__0PyEKq__divider:before{left:0}.Login-module__0PyEKq__divider:after{right:0}.Login-module__0PyEKq__label{text-align:left;letter-spacing:2px;margin-bottom:6px;font-size:16px;font-weight:700;display:block}.Login-module__0PyEKq__input{border:1px solid #ccc;border-radius:6px;width:-webkit-fill-available;margin-bottom:14px;padding:12px;font-size:16px}.Login-module__0PyEKq__submitBtn{color:#fff;cursor:pointer;width:100%;font-size:16px;font-weight:700;font-family:var(--montserrat-font);background:#2a4996;border:none;border-radius:6px;padding:12px}.Login-module__0PyEKq__submitBtn:hover{color:#fff;background:#2a4996}.Login-module__0PyEKq__links{color:#333;letter-spacing:2px;font-size:16px;font-family:var(--montserrat-font);text-align:center;margin-top:0}.Login-module__0PyEKq__links a{color:#2a4996;font-weight:600;font-family:var(--montserrat-font);cursor:pointer;text-decoration:none}.Login-module__0PyEKq__links a:hover{text-decoration:underline}.Login-module__0PyEKq__errorMsg{color:red;text-align:left;border-radius:4px;margin:10px 0 16px;padding:8px 12px;font-size:15px;line-height:20px}
.textBox .input-group input.form-field{border:2px solid #ddd;padding:1rem}
/*# sourceMappingURL=2s49xqdmdcgcx.css.map*/